You’re an Econ guy, what’s the book say on what the Athletics do with Kyler Murray? If he plays football you lose a top 10 pick for no compensation but there has to be a limit on how much to increase their offer before there is no value surplus. What’s the value of that pick? 10 million? 15 million?
Keith Law
1:17
The pick is sunk. The question is whether Murray would be worth some enormous additional sum of money. I think the risk of no return there is high enough that he's not.

Do you think the slow free agency is bad for the game?  If so, do you have any ideas to fix it?
Keith Law
1:20
I think it's terrible for the game, but I don't think there is a quick or simple fix for it. I believe ultimately the league will need to guarantee some percentage of revenue goes to the players, like in the NBA.

How did the Mets do this offseason?  Will McNeil get regular ABs in the OF?  Thoughts on Alonso?
Keith Law
1:22
Mixed bag this offseason. Did poorly in trades, well in free agency overall (other than Familia). Would like to see either Alonso or Smith get everyday AB at 1b - both are ready, and blocking either one with veterans is counterproductive.
